Output 90f16e2596b52d148a65724eac1f7becb16ab16a5332f0e0835e047c4babc124:0

value
5683926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e84f2ddbd6f1d0e9bc0484ed6cd34d1f7c0efb OP_EQUAL
address
3KeAfGv2kz6NtX4eczKDd5HX4FjbZiD2Qd
transaction
90f16e2596b52d148a65724eac1f7becb16ab16a5332f0e0835e047c4babc124
spent
true